Mastiii 4 Teaser Review : Riteish, Aftab, Vivek’s Reunion Falls Flat With Vulgar, Outdated Comedy

It has been well over decades since Masti introduced Riteish Deshmukh, Aftab Shivdasani, and Vivek Oberoi as three mischievous boys coping with extramarital affairs in the name of comedy. Although the first one introduced freshness to adult-comedy in Bollywood, the sequels later have depended significantly on age-old gags and stale conventions. Now, in 2025, the Mastiii 4 teaser comes around, but rather than building anticipation, it appears to be a desperate attempt that can't quite match its own hype.
Storyline
The trailer promises more of the same: three aging men with wandering eyes, sex-crazed escapades, and a series of pratfall misadventures on the verge of the ridiculous. The funny comedy, which was kind of interesting in the begining, now is painfully repetitive. Rather than adapting to the times, the film stays in the early 2000s, and completly ignored the changing audience tastes and a demand for the wiser comedy. The cast returns with the same formula—men pursuing women, double entendres, and big reactions—and it's just more cringeworthy this time.
Positive Points
To give credit where it's due, the teaser does send out a nostalgia feeling for the supporters of the first Masti. After Seeing Riteish, Aftab, and Vivek together will hit back the old memories in some individuals. The rapport between the actors still remains intact, and their comfort level with one another translates well on the screen. For viewers seeking a flashback of slapstick chaos, Mastiii 4 may provide fleeting laughs.
Negative Points
Yet the negatives overshadow the positives. Seeing actors near their fifties engaging in childish tricks is embarrassing instead of funny. The jokes, which are so dependent on innuendos, ring as stale and uninspired. Instead of breaking new ground, the teaser rehashes humor already so stretched thin in the previous segments of the franchise. Worse still, women are still depicted in a narrow manner, making them mere objects of desire rather than developed characters. The lack of new writing or contemporary comedic sensibilities renders the teaser to be from a different era, awkwardly inserted into the modern world.

Overall: Mastiii 4 teaser attempts to bring back nostalgia but ends up pointing out how much life has gone out of the franchise. What should have been a playful reunion reads like an overused joke that should have ended years ago. Unless the movie surprises with wiser writing, this installment seems destined to be a letdown.
